First Griffon Vulture of the year
We visited the El Torcal nature reserve. Located 30km or so north of Malaga near the town of Antequera, the reserve is internationally renowned for its limestone rock formations and supports a unique range of flora and fauna. They fly over Lanjaron on their their route to migrate south.

I managed to snap this picture of a Griffon Vulture, the first for this year
